Can plastic seals be used on electronic devices?

Can plastic seals be used on electronic devices? That's a question I've been asked a bunch of times as a plastic seal supplier. And let me tell you, the answer isn't as straightforward as you might think.

First off, what are plastic seals? Well, they're basically made from different types of plastics and are used to seal things up. There are all kinds of plastic seals out there, like Hydraulic Cylinder Seal, Engineering Plastic Drain Valve Disc, and F265 POM. Each type has its own unique properties and uses.

Now, when it comes to using plastic seals on electronic devices, there are several factors to consider. One of the main things is the environment where the electronic device will be used. If it's going to be in a dry and clean environment, then plastic seals can work just fine. They can help keep out dust and small particles that could potentially damage the electronic components.

For example, in a home or office setting, plastic seals can be used to seal the edges of a laptop or a desktop computer case. This helps prevent dust from getting inside and clogging up the fans or other internal parts. And since plastic is relatively inexpensive compared to other sealing materials, it's a cost - effective option for manufacturers.

But what if the electronic device is going to be used in a more harsh environment? Say, outdoors where it might be exposed to moisture, extreme temperatures, or chemicals. In this case, the choice of plastic seal becomes crucial. Some plastics are more resistant to moisture and chemicals than others. For instance, F265 POM has good chemical resistance and can withstand a certain degree of temperature variations. So, if the electronic device is going to be used in a chemical - laden industrial environment, a seal made from this type of plastic could be a good choice.

Another important aspect is the electrical properties of the plastic seal. Electronic devices are all about electricity, so the plastic seal shouldn't interfere with the electrical signals. Most plastics are insulators, which is a good thing in terms of not causing short - circuits. However, some plastics may have static - generating properties. Static electricity can be a big problem for electronic components as it can cause sudden voltage spikes and damage the sensitive chips. So, when choosing a plastic seal for an electronic device, it's important to select one that has anti - static properties.

Let's talk about the manufacturing process of electronic devices. Plastic seals are relatively easy to manufacture. They can be molded into different shapes and sizes using injection molding or extrusion processes. This makes them highly customizable for different types of electronic devices. Whether it's a small smartphone or a large industrial control panel, plastic seals can be designed to fit perfectly.

In addition, plastic seals can also provide some level of shock absorption. Electronic devices can be dropped or bumped during transportation or normal use. A well - designed plastic seal can help absorb some of the impact and protect the internal components from damage.

However, there are also some limitations to using plastic seals on electronic devices. One of the biggest issues is their durability over time. Plastics can degrade when exposed to sunlight, heat, and certain chemicals. This degradation can lead to the seal losing its effectiveness. For example, a plastic seal that was initially air - tight may start to crack or become brittle after a few years of use.

Also, plastic seals may not be suitable for high - pressure applications. If an electronic device is going to be used in a high - pressure environment, like deep - sea exploration equipment, then a more robust sealing material might be required.

So, can plastic seals be used on electronic devices? The answer is yes, but with some caveats. It all depends on the specific requirements of the electronic device, such as the environment, electrical properties, and durability needs.
